(3/x)-1=(7/x-20)
why are there brackets around the right side? Did you mean 7/(x-20) ?
I can only take your question at face value the way you typed it.
Then it would be the same as
3/x - 1 = 7/x - 20
multiply each term by x
3 - x = 7 - 20x
19x = 4
x = 4/19
